What happens if a cat eats a Christmas cactus?

When your cat eats a Christmas cactus, your first concern should be the health of the cat. Is Christmas cactus bad for cats? The answer depends on how you grow your plants. According to the ASPCA plant database, Christmas cactus is not toxic or poisonous to cats, but insecticides and other chemicals used on the plant may be toxic.

What is the difference between Thanksgiving cactus and Christmas cactus?

The Thanksgiving cactus has 2-4 saw-toothed serrations (claws) along the margins and the Christmas cactus has rounded serrations (scallops). While Christmas cactus is non-toxic to cats, fertilisers and pest control used on or around the plant may be potentially toxic.

What do you do with Christmas cactus when a cat breaks it?

When the cat breaks stems off of your Christmas cactus, you make new plants by rooting the stems. You’ll need stems with three to five segments. Lay the stems aside in an area out of direct sunlight for a day or two to let the broken end callus over.

What is a Christmas cactus?

Christmas Cactus ( Schlumbergera x buckleyi or sometimes mistakenly known as Schlumbergera bridgesii) is one of the 6-9 cacti in the genus Schlumbergera ( Zygocactus, Epiphyllum, Opuntiopsis or Zygocereus) in the cacti family, Cactaceae. The other famous one is the Thanksgiving cactus ( Schlumbergera truncata ).
